我正在尝试设置一个中间清漆服务器,允许xyz.com上的Rails应用程序在其他几个域名上工作。发生的情况是,Rails应用程序不时输出301/302重定向,而清漆显然不会更改这些标头,因此访问者被重定向到原来的站点(在面向公众的清漆服务器后面),所以.错误。是否有一种方法可以在事物的清漆侧配置此重写?在vcl_fetch下,我尝试了以下方法: set req.ur
我有多个子域指向一个清漆实例。我在文档中看到,应该使用PCRE regex。我相信当请求url是“”并且应该设置15sttl时,下面的正则表达式应该返回true。我也尝试过了(req.url ~“internal.my.com”),因为我读到如果请求url的任何部分包含该字符串,它应该匹配。# Cache for a longer time if the internal.my.com URL isn't used if (req.url ~